In a game that showcased both team’s grit, Gonzaga’s Graham Ike continued his scorching streak, dropping 20 points and adding three blocks. And this is the part most people miss: Ike’s performance marked his ninth consecutive game with 20 or more points—the longest streak by a Gonzaga player in the past 20 seasons. Oh, and did we mention he’s the only active Division I player with 2,000 career points and 1,000 rebounds? Talk about a stat line that demands respect. Davis Fogle chipped in 18 points, while Emmanuel Innocenti added 13, helping the Bulldogs secure their 15th conference win—their most since the 2020-21 season.

Pacific, however, didn’t go down without a fight. Elias Ralph and Justin Rochelin each scored 12 points, and Wainwright’s 10 points—including those clutch 3-pointers—kept the Tigers in the game. Gonzaga responded with a 6-0 run to regain control, pulling ahead 56-49 and never looking back.
